The most famous was Charles Darwin, a naturalist employed aboard the HMS Beagle. It was here that Darwin formulated much of his theories about evolution.

Island where Darwin observed variation in tortoises?

While Charles Darwin was in Galapagos, he visited the islands of Floreana, Isabela, San Cristóbal, and Santiago only.


Who first visited the Galapagos island?

The islands were first mapped and named by the buccaneer Ambrose Cowley in 1684.
